"Injustice" meaning in English

See Injustice in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Forms: Injustices [plural]
Etymology: Blend of injustice + Justice Etymology templates: {{blend|en|injustice|Justice}} Blend of injustice + Justice Head templates: {{en-noun}} Injustice (plural Injustices)
  1. (humorous, derogatory) Justice (title of a justice of court), seen as being unjust. Tags: derogatory, humorous
